Swing GUI 生成器(原 Matisse 项目)
利用自动间隔和对齐创建具有专业外观的 GUI。
专业 GUI 生成
您可以在客户面前使用 GUI 生成器来构建 GUI 原型。通过将 GUI 组件从面板拖放到画布并进行定位来设计 Swing GUI。GUI 生成器自动调整正确的间隔和布局。在标签、按钮和文本框中单击即可在相应位置编辑它们的属性。
新的帮助条显示上下文关联性的提示,这些提示包含这些信息:关于当前选定的组件所提供的操作,以及用户在将来通过哪些快捷键提高工作效率。 NetBeans IDE 带有内建的、对 GUI 本地化和易用性的支持。
|
 |
标准和自定义的 GUI 组件
可扩展的组件面板内置了预安装的 Swing 和 AWT 组件并包含一个可视化菜单设计器。使用组件阅览器可以查看组件的树状结构和属性。
|
 |
Beans 绑定技术 (JSR 295) 支持
利用 Beans 绑定技术和 Java 持久化 API 使得创建 Swing 桌面数据库应用程序比以往更容易。使用新的 Java 桌面应用程序项目模板,您可以快速设置一个表单来显示数据库表并且可以修改数据库。通过将一个表从“运行环境”窗口拖放到表单中,即可将一个数 据库表绑定到一个已存在的表单上。
视频:Swing 应用程序框架和 Beans 绑定
Swing 应用程序框架 (JSR 296) 支持
Swing 应用程序框架简化了对应用程序生命周期、行为以及资源的控制。利用所提供的代码完成工具和组块,可以比以往更快地开发中小型桌面应用程序。通过将菜单 项拖 放到画布上可以快速直观地创建菜单;通过在“设计”视图中单击并录入,您可以在线添加助记符并重命名菜单项。
|
 |
GUI 生成器相关学习资料
|